Finland – shortcomings found in recycling system for old cars

The recycling system for disused vehicles is not working properly in Finland. Many of the cars that are scrapped have not had hazardous materials properly dealt with before being recycled. Reciclagem de fios e cabos elétricos.

A indústria eletro-eletrônica vem aumentando a quantidade de sucatas geradas anualmente. Por este motivo necessita-se de reciclagem, para que se evite o desperdício de matérias-primas e de recursos naturais não-renováveis.
